[英]Can I setup an ssl certificate for AWS lightsail without the Load Balancer?
[英]Can I setup SSL on an AWS provided ALB subdomain without owning a domain?
我在 AWS ECS 有以下设置:
/api/*
请求执行代理我想在 AWS 提供的这个子域中为 ALB 设置 SSL 证书和 HTTPS 侦听器 - 我该怎么做?
PS当我们附加自定义域时,我已经看到了带有 HTTPS 侦听器的 ALB 选项,即example.com
,AWS 将为它提供 SSL 证书。 但这是一个宠物项目环境,我不担心真正的领域。
我想在 AWS 提供的这个子域中为 ALB 设置 SSL 证书和 HTTPS 侦听器 - 我该怎么做?
你不能这样做。 这不是您的域(AWS 拥有它),您不能将任何 SSL 证书与其关联。 您必须拥有自己控制的域。 获得域后,您可以从 AWS ACM 获得免费的 SSL 证书。
您可以将 ALB 放在CloudFront后面,与 ALB 不同,它默认为您提供 TLS 证书。 因此,您可以通过以下方式处理您的申请:
https ://d3n6jitgitr0i4.cloudfront.net
除了 TLS 证书之外,它还使您能够在 CloudFront 的边缘站点缓存 static 资源,并改善 TLS 握手往返的延迟。
这可能是一个不使用子域但使用路径重定向的解决方案
https://caddy.community/t/caddy-2-reverse-proxy-to-path/9193
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.